A cross-section of the economy

Where the work went is its own kind of résumé. The customer list ran across the Brazilian economy of the era: the datacentres of national and international banks and credit-card processors, the BM&F futures exchange, and investment and stock-trading brokers; Rede Globo across many sites in Rio de Janeiro and São Paulo, Editora Abril, and print and cable-TV media; Petrobras throughout both states, Votorantim and VCP, and chemical and pharmaceutical industry; airlines, national bus-line operators, insurers, call centres, retail and fast-food chains, construction and development firms; mobile-phone and cable operators; federal, state, and municipal government; and large, geographically distributed university campuses. Few weeks looked alike.

A quarter of a megabit to New Hampshire

The connectivity of the era deserves recording, because the numbers sound implausible now. The São Paulo office reached corporate headquarters in Rochester, New Hampshire over a 256 kbps private line. That single link carried an entire country operation: mail, file access, internal systems, and whatever else needed the other end. Brazil held 134.141.239.0/24 out of Cabletron's own registered space, and it was possible to reach the internet through the United States over that private line - though in practice the local Brazilian connection carried most of it, at either 2 or 10 Mbps depending on which year is being remembered, and that uncertainty is left standing rather than resolved into a false precision. Dial-up did the rest. The modems were USRobotics Sportsters, replaced as the speeds stepped up through 14.4, 28.8, 33.6 and finally 56k, with a pair of the more expensive Couriers arriving as a gift from a client - which is roughly how anyone outside a corporate purchasing department came to own one.

The always-on superhighway

One thread from the Enterasys years deserves recording precisely, because it is easy to overstate. This was the height of policy-based networking, Enterasys built its Secure Networks architecture around role-based access and 802.1X, and the work sat in close, constant contact with the demanding world of contact-center networks and the Avaya and Cisco IP-telephony systems running on top of them. The familiarity ran deep, but it was familiarity from the network side. The role was never unified-communications engineering; it carried no telephony certification and no hands-on UC work. What it delivered instead was the layer all of that depends on: a secure, redundant, resilient, monitored, guaranteed always-on superhighway for voice and mission-critical traffic. Being clear about where that line sits is part of describing the work honestly.
